Inter Miami’s Lineup: Stars and Strategy
Inter Miami has seen a dramatic evolution in recent years, largely thanks to their acquisition of high-profile players like Lionel Messi, Sergio Busquets, and Jordi Alba. These additions have elevated the team’s profile and expectation levels, making them one of the most exciting teams to watch in the MLS.
Key Players to Watch:
Lionel Messi (Forward): The Argentine legend needs no introduction. Messi’s dribbling, vision, and finishing have made him one of the greatest players in the history of football. His presence on the field is a game-changer, and his ability to control the tempo of the match and create opportunities for his teammates will be crucial for Inter Miami.
Sergio Busquets (Midfield): Another major signing for the team, Busquets brings a wealth of experience from his time at Barcelona. As a defensive midfielder, his tactical intelligence and passing range will be vital in breaking down opposing attacks and maintaining possession.
Josef Martínez (Forward): The Venezuelan striker is a proven goal scorer in the MLS. Martínez has been a consistent performer for Inter Miami and his ability to find space in the box makes him a constant threat to opposing defenses.
DeAndre Yedlin (Defender): A player with extensive international experience, Yedlin’s pace and defensive abilities make him an essential part of Inter Miami’s backline. His overlapping runs on the right flank provide width and balance to the team.
Tactical Approach:
Inter Miami is likely to set up in a 4-3-3 formation, with Messi leading the attack supported by Martínez and another forward or winger. Busquets will anchor the midfield, offering defensive cover while distributing passes to Messi and the wide players. In defense, Yedlin and left-back Kelvin Leerdam will need to offer support in both defensive and attacking situations.
With Messi and Busquets orchestrating the game from the middle of the park, Inter Miami’s offensive game will revolve around quick transitions, possession-based play, and utilizing their speed on the wings. Expect them to press high up the field, using their star power to dominate the ball and control the match.
NY Red Bulls’ Lineup: Youth and Energy
The New York Red Bulls are renowned for their high-pressing, fast-paced style of play, a philosophy that has been ingrained in the club’s DNA for years. Their lineup, while not boasting the same global superstars as Inter Miami, is filled with exciting young talent and hard-working players.
Key Players to Watch:
Lewis Morgan (Winger): Morgan has been one of the standout players for the Red Bulls. His pace and ability to take on defenders make him a constant threat on the flanks. His crosses and ability to cut inside will be important for creating chances.
Patryk Klimala (Forward): The Polish striker is a dynamic presence in the attack. Klimala’s physicality and movement off the ball are assets that make him a tough player to defend against. His link-up play with Morgan and his ability to finish chances will be key for the Red Bulls.
Sean Nealis (Defender): As a center-back, Nealis has been solid at the heart of the Red Bulls defense. His leadership and ability to read the game will be crucial in containing Inter Miami’s potent attacking force.
Frankie Amaya (Midfield): Amaya is a versatile midfielder with a great work rate. His ability to break up opposition attacks and transition the ball quickly is something that will help the Red Bulls in midfield battles.
Tactical Approach:
The Red Bulls are likely to stick to their traditional 4-2-3-1 formation, with Klimala leading the line supported by Morgan and another attacking midfielder. Amaya and another central midfielder will provide defensive cover and facilitate the team’s counter-attacking play.
The team’s defensive setup is centered around a high pressing game, with the midfielders and forwards tasked with putting pressure on the ball and forcing turnovers. With the likes of Morgan and Klimala, the Red Bulls will look to break quickly in transition, using their pace to exploit any space left by Inter Miami’s defenders. Defensively, the Red Bulls will need to stay compact and disciplined, minimizing space for Messi to operate in.

FAQs
How did Lionel Messi perform in the match against the New York Red Bulls?
Lionel Messi delivered an exceptional performance, setting multiple MLS records. He provided five assists, all in the second half, setting a new league record for assists in a half. Additionally, Messi scored a goal in the 50th minute, contributing to a 6-2 victory over the Red Bulls.
Were there any notable absences in the Inter Miami lineup?
Yes, several key players were absent due to injuries and international duties. Lionel Messi was recovering from a strained hamstring and did not start the match. Additionally, players like Fede Redondo, Diego Gomez, David Ruiz, Shanyder Borgelin, and Israel Boatright were unavailable due to international commitments.
Were there any significant injuries or suspensions affecting the New York Red Bulls’ lineup?
Yes, the Red Bulls faced several absences. Dylan Nealis was unavailable due to core surgery, and Lewis Morgan was out with a similar issue. Kyle Duncan was suspended due to yellow card accumulation. Additionally, Cory Burke was absent with a hip issue but returned to make the bench.
